How To Submit a Tech Support Ticket
This Anet instructional sticky has several errors:
When running GameAdvisor.exe, select Guild Wars game for GW2.
This is incorrect- the latest version of GameAdvisor.exe has a dedicated GW2 game selection.
The result of running Game Advisor will be a file called Guild Wars Test.txt.
This is incorrect- Game Advisor.exe produces a file called Guild Wars 2 Test.zip.
Attach the output of Game Advisor.exe to your Tech Support post.
This is impossible. The Tech Support website returns an error when trying to attach a .zip file.
Attach both the Game Advisor output file and ArenaNet.log to your TS post
This is impossible- the Tech Support website does not permit more than one file attachment, and overwrites the first file when the second file is attached.

After running the GW2 function in Game Advisor.exe, I found that the output zip file actually contains ArenaNet.log! Accordingly, I suggest the following two specific fixes to the Tech Support website:
1. Enable zip file attachments
2. Revise the ‘How-To’ sticky to specify using the GW2 function for GW2 instead of the GW1 function for GW2, and specify that only the Guild Wars 2 Test.zip file need be attached since that file already contains ArenaNet.log.
